About This Coffee

In the highlands of Lintong Nihuta, not far from Lake Toba, grows one of the most characteristic coffees of Indonesia. The region lies on a volcanic plateau that was created around 70,000 years ago by the eruption of the Toba supervolcano. Typical for Sumatra is the traditional processing method Giling Basah. The word Bumbu comes from Indonesian and means spice, referring to the typical spicy-earthy aroma of Sumatra coffees.
